Our congregation has a as our charism the call the love
of God as shown in the Incarnation a real and tangible presence in the world
today. Pope Francis said 'In this Holy Year, we look forward to the experience
of opening our hearts to those living on the outermost fringes of society:
fringes which modern society itself creates. How many uncertain and painful
situations there are in the world today! How many are the wounds borne by the
flesh of those who have no voice because their cry is muffled and drowned out
by the indifference of the rich! During this Jubilee, the Church will be called
even more to heal these wounds, to assuage them with the oil of consolation, to
bind them with mercy and cure them with solidarity and vigilant care. Let us
not fall into humiliating indifference or a monotonous routine that prevents us
from discovering what is new! Let us ward off destructive cynicism! Let us open
our eyes and see the misery of the world, the wounds of our brothers and
sisters who are denied their dignity, and let us recognize that we are
compelled to heed their cry for help! May we reach out to them and support them
so they can feel the warmth of our presence, our friendship, and our
fraternity! May their cry become our own, and together may we break down the
barriers of indifference that too often reign supreme and mask our hypocrisy
and egoism!'
So, for us, this eclesial time is very important because Love, is our Mission.
